Antioxidant activity of different parts of Lespedeza bicolor and isolation of antioxidant compound

In this study, total antioxidant properties of extracts from different parts of Lespedeza bicolor were determined using techniques of measuring 1,1-diphenyl-2-picryl hydrazyl/2,2'-azino-bis(3-ethylbenzothiazoline-6-sulfonic acid)-radical scavenging activity and total phenolic contents. The total antioxidant activities of leaf, stem and root extracts from various solvents (water, 50, 70, 100% ethanol, and hot-water) indicated that 50 and 70% ethanol extracts have high radical scavenging activities and phenolic contents. A systematic approach was used to determine the total antioxidant activity of different solvent fractions of the Lespedeza bicolor extracts, partitioning with chloroform, ethyl acetate, n-butanol, and water, and the ethyl acetate fraction was found to have the strongest antioxidant activity. Antioxidant assay-guided isolation was carried out to isolate potential antioxidant compounds. The ethyl acetate fraction of the leaf extract was subjected to silica gel, LH-20 and RP-18 column chromatography successively, and afforded compound 1, which was identified as eriodictyol by NMR and MS analysis, after which its antioxidant activity was determined. © The Korean Society of Food Science and Technology.
